About Air New Zealand
Air New Zealand Limited serves as the premier flag carrier airline for New Zealand. Headquartered in Auckland, the airline specializes in operating regular passenger flights, encompassing 20 domestic and 30 international destinations spanning 18 countries. Its flight routes are predominantly centered around the Pacific Rim region.

Air New Zealand is actively seeking expressions of interest from qualified pilots eager to join our esteemed turboprop fleets. The opportunity awaits for individuals aspiring to occupy the First Officer position, where they will be seated in the right-hand position of either an ATR or a Dash 8 Q300 aircraft.
Within our turboprop fleets, entry into the First Officer role is the starting point, with positions available at multiple bases across the country. This presents a unique chance for individuals to embark on a career in propeller-driven aviation or to establish a pathway towards transitioning into our jet fleet. To be eligible for consideration in this exciting opportunity, candidates are required to satisfy the following prerequisites:
1.Hold a NZCAA Commercial Pilot License (CPL) or Airline Transport Pilot License (ATPL).
2.Possess a NZCAA Multi-Engine Instrument Rating (MEIR).
3.Maintain a valid NZCAA Class 1 Medical Certification.
4.Accumulate a minimum of 500 hours of total flight time.
5.Log at least 25 night flight hours.
6.Attain a minimum of 40 hours of Instrument Flight Time.
7.Possess NZCAA BTK/BGT endorsements.
8.Hold University Entrance or its equivalent.
9.Demonstrate Level 6 English Language Proficiency.
10.Be a New Zealand resident, permanent resident, citizen, or an Australian citizen.
11.Exhibit the ability to travel internationally, including holding a valid passport with required visas.
